Step 1. Stand close to the load with your feet

spread apart about shoulder width, with
one foot slightly in front of the other for
balance.

Step 2. Squat down bending at the knees (not your

waist). Tuck your chin while keeping your
back as vertical as possible.

Step 3. Get a firm grasp of the object before be-

ginning the lift. Begin slowly lifting with
your LEGS by straightening them. Never
twist your body during this step.

Step 4. Once the lift is complete, keep the object

as close to the body as possible. As the
load’s center of gravity moves away from
the body, there is a dramatic increase in
stress to the lumbar region of the back.

Step 5. If you must turn while carrying the load,

turn using your feet-not your torso. To
place the object below the level of your
waist, follow the same procedures in re-
verse order. Remember, keep your back
as vertical as possible and bend at the
knees.

How to Lift Safely

• Before lifting, take a moment to think about what

you’re about to do.

• Examine the object for sharp corners, slippery spots

or other potential hazards. Know your limit and don’t
try to exceed it.

• Ask for help if needed, or if possible, divide the load

to make it lighter.

• Know where you are going to set the item down, and

make sure it and your path are free of obstructions.
Then follow these steps:
